引言:
在信息技術迅猛發展的新時代下,如何加快實施科技強企戰略,強力推進企業信息化建設,虛擬化技術在其中扮演著不可或缺的角色。可以說“云、移、大、物、智”不僅是未來企業信息技術發展的方向,更是以虛擬化技術為核心在互聯網中得到廣泛應用和普及。我們為什么需要虛擬化技術?他能給我們帶來什么好處呢?我想從以下五個方面去闡述。
正文:
理由一:數據中心發展的必然趨勢。隨著各地數據中心的建設,以及全球網絡的互聯互通,信息的數據量也在隨時間的推移呈現出指數級的增加。由于業務不同,無論企業大小,都需要部署大量服務器,此時數據中心的架構就凸顯出來;
理由二:節約成本、空間。任何一個數據中心建設都需要考慮配置像DNS服務器這樣資源占用率很小的設備,我們可能只需要分配出512MB的內存以及低配的CPU處理器就可完全勝任,但是目前市面上所購買的服務器最低配置都遠遠超過所需要的要求。此時在單獨去購買物理主機不但浪費資金還浪費空間,但我們可以通過虛擬化技術限制CPU、內存使用率來達到節約資源,節省成本開支的目的;
理由三:便于維護,提供高可用性。以前維護物理主機,比如增加個網卡,必須先關閉主機中斷業務后再進行添加,但有了虛擬化技術,我們可以在業務不中斷的情況下,通過虛擬化中VMotion技術,實現在線動態遷移虛擬機,大大降低了業務中斷導致數據損壞的風險,實現了高可用性;
理由四:資源的合理利用。舉個例子,有兩臺物理機,上面跑著10個占用資源相同的業務,如果是原來部署方式,兩臺物理機上可能分別運行為3個和7個的業務數。這樣運行多個業務的服務器資源消耗更多,影響了主機的使用壽命,通過虛擬化技術可以將業務數自動的進行動態遷移,使兩臺主機都分別運行5個業務,平衡各虛擬機主機上CPU、內存使用率,達到實現負載均衡的效果;
理由五:虛擬化的存儲技術能更好地保障數據的安全性。存儲作為一種信息記錄,方便了人們的生活。然而如何保障信息數據的完整性、可靠性顯得尤為重要。我們曾通過RAID技術將磁盤陣列中的數據切割成許多區段,分別存放在組成陣列的各個硬盤上,當數組中任意一個硬盤發生故障時,通過計算仍可讀出數據,確保數據的完整。現在有了虛擬化技術,我們可以通過虛擬化中存儲的VMotion技術,動態的遷移數據存放位置,提升了數據存儲空間的靈活性。其實,虛擬化技術中絕大部分的功能通過VMware VCenter Server來實現,而其中核心的功能VMotion 技術,將在下面簡單探討下。
首先VMotion(遷移)技術:分為VMware VMotion(虛擬機的遷移)和Storage VMotion(存儲的遷移)。
VMware VMotion:主要實現運行在物理主機上面的虛擬機可以動態地進行在線遷移。前提條件是在線的遷移一定需要一個共享的存儲。兩個主機可同時訪問這個共享存儲。可能會有疑問,現在單個主機數據動輒幾百G那么如何去實現秒級數據遷移,瞬間復制這么大的數據呢?其實很簡單,目前我們物理主機只提供兩個東西,一個是CPU一個是內存。本地硬盤基本上不提供存儲數據功能。而虛擬機運行的數據主要由共享存儲來提供。遷移主機時,共享存儲不動,此時只需要將CPU和內存進行遷移。目前技術2G容量的數據對于數據遷移來說很快。所以利用VMware VMotion技術可以動態在線遷移虛擬機。
Storage VMotion:可在虛擬機運行時將虛擬機及其磁盤文件從一個數據存儲遷移到另一個數據存儲;還可將虛擬機從陣列上移開,以便進行維護或升級;也可靈活地優化磁盤性能,或轉換磁盤類型(可用于回收空間)。通過 Storage vMotion 遷移時,虛擬機不會更改執行主機。
總結:
為更好地打造企業數據,建設智慧企業,全面推動企業工作質量變革、效率變革、動力變革,實現企業信息化戰斗力的跨越式發展。我們應抓住這個機遇,利用好虛擬化技術更好地解決企業信息系統缺乏統一管理,設備資源利用率不充分,數據安全無保障等問題。努力為打造企業信息化升級版不懈奮斗!